Al Mubaraq Grand Mosque - History of the Symbol of Syiar, Riau Islands, Indonesia
Al Mubaraq Grand Mosque is a mosque with a land area of ​​3,600 m2 and has a building area of ​​242 m2. This mosque is located in the Merai village, which is in the Meral sub-district, Karimun district, which is precisely in the Riau Islands. This mosque is not far from the city of Karimun. This mosque is on the beach. According to the local community, this mosque is the result of such valuable Malay heritage. The mosque, which was made by an architect that is so unique and has high value since the 17th century, was made by King Abdullah Ahmad Engku Tuah, the grandson of a Raja Haji Fisabilillah. This mosque was built in 1873 AD. Al Mubaraq Grand Mosque Facilities After many times doing the restoration of this mosque, there are many facilities that we encounter in this mosque. It has a terrace around the mosque, although in fact, the terrace used to be just behind it. Besides that, don't forget there is a minaret as a unique mosque in Riau.
